LEWIS Haldane scored with his first touch to send Yate through to the second round of the Red Insure Cup with a 2-1 win at home to Clevedon Town on Tuesday night.
Haldane had only just come off the bench when he forced home the winner with eight minutes left.
Jordan Rogers had earlier given Yate the lead when he headed home Jake Cox's cross after 16 minutes but Clevedon found parity within three minutes of the second half when Kye Thomas drove home from the edge of the box.
Yate are at home to North Leigh in the FA Trophy Preliminary Round on Saturday, 3pm.
